A Department of Revenue correction dropped the county’s General Transportation Aid by roughly $128,000; staff will reduce maintenance/material costs accordingly. Committee approved vouchers and reviewed CIP, including a $1.5 million equipment budget and a $3 million bond transfer into funds.

Dunn County staff told the highway committee on Jan. 7 that a corrected General Transportation Aid (GTA) calculation lowered the county’s GTA entitlement by about $128,000, and staff will adjust maintenance and material budgets to align with the revised amount.
